Fluence, a Siemens and AES company, is a global market leader in energy storage products and services, and digital applications for renewables and storage. The company has more than 3.4 GW of energy storage deployed or contracted in 29 markets globally, and more than 4.5 GW of wind, solar, and storage assets optimized or contracted in Australia and California. Through our products, services and AI-enabled Fluence IQ platform, Fluence is helping customers around the world drive more resilient electric grids and a more sustainable future. Position Overview and Key Responsibilities

As a Finance Controller, you will be responsible for overseeing and managing the financial activities of the organization. You will play a crucial role in ensuring the accuracy of financial reporting, implementing effective financial controls, and providing strategic financial guidance to support business decisions.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in finance, accounting, and leadership, with a focus on optimizing financial performance and mitigating risks.

Key Responsibilities Include

  • Prepare and analyze monthly, quarterly, and annual financial statements, ensuring accuracy and timeliness.
  • Lead the financial reporting and compliance for the India legal entity
  • Lead the month end process & MIS
  • Lead the statutory audit and ensure that there is no observation by auditors.
  • Closely work with global shared services team and regularly monitor to ensure smooth operations
  • Create detailed reports for senior management, highlighting key insights and actionable recommendations.
  • Monitor and manage the organization's cash flow to ensure liquidity and optimal use of funds.
  • Review monthly billing processes to ensure it is compliant with transfer pricing rules.
  • Interact with various teams to gather relevant financial data and facilitate smooth operations.
  • Ensure effective communication and coordination between multiple departments.
  • Identify, assess, and manage financial risks, ensuring the implementation of risk mitigation strategies.
  • Collaborate with diverse stakeholders to align financial strategies with organizational objectives.
  • Manage stakeholder expectations and resolve any financial-related concerns promptly.
  • Demonstrate hands-on experience in establishing and managing finance operations within a GCC environment.
  • Identify and implement best practices tailored to GCC processes and structures.
  • Lead projects related to GCC expansion or optimization, ensuring seamless integration with global initiatives.
  • Participate in business development initiatives, providing financial expertise for potential investments or partnerships.

Qualifications

Education

  • Chartered Accountant (CA) with minimum 6 - 8 years of relevant experience in finance, with at least 3 years in a leadership role within a GCC or multinational environment.
  • Proven expertise in GCC setup, financial reporting, transfer pricing, and stakeholder engagement.

Skills

  • Exceptional anal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Strong knowledge of international financial regulations and standards.
  • Proficiency in financial software such as SAP S4 Hana
  •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ced, dynamic environment.

Key Competencies

  • Leadership and team management abilities.
  • Attention to detail and a commitment to accuracy.
  • Strategic thinking and adaptability.
  • Strong interpersonal skills and stakeholder management.
